I have a new application and I don't know how is the easy way to solve it.

There are up to 10 machine tools controlled by Modicon PLC's (Micro and few Premium).Our customer wants a kind of monitor system installed on a PC computer.They want to know how many pieces are made per a day,nomber of faults,working or stationary time of each machine tool.

I can write a good application on a PC and I can use Database files for read/save data.

I would like to know if there is a ModBus driver or application wich can communicate with this PLC's running on PC and to get data from PLC's in one of the the following databese file format:
Paradox-3.5
Paradox-4
Paradox-5.0 for Windows
Paradox-7
DB2
DBase IV
ORACLE

All informations are to be read from PLC's one time at 4 hours each day of a week.

Dear Mr.Cristian SANDOR,

I would suggest you to go for a Modbus Master Driver which can communicate with the Modicon PLC & it sits on your PC. Once the data is acquired into the PC, we can represent it in any Database format.

Hello Mr. Cristian SANDOR

Your application seems to be interesting. We do have Modbus drivers and Dynamic link librarires that can run on PC and fetch data from MODBUS PLCs. Once data is available in PC, it can be converted to any database format and stored in any of the database mentioned by you.
What exactly you have to do is to get a MODBUS Master dll and use it in your application.
